Roald Dahl - George's Marvellous Medicine - First UK Edition 1981 - SIGNED by Quentin Blake
A first edition, first printing of �George's Marvellous Medicine� published by Cape in 1981. A near fine book without inscriptions - a trace of spotting to the top edge in a near fine wrapper without fade to the spine. Clipped, with a little rubbing to the corners. SIGNED to the title page by Blake without dedication. A darkly funny children�s story about George, who creates a magical concoction to cure his horrid Grandma. Using wild household ingredients�from shampoo to engine oil�he brews a medicine that makes Grandma grow enormously tall, then shrink to nothing when George can�t recreate it. The tale highlights mischief, imagination, and consequences, with quirky language, surprising transformations, and Dahl�s characteristic blend of humour and menace.
